Details for Megaparsec (Cosmological Distance)
Introduction : The megaparsec equals 1 million parsecs, the fundamental unit for measuring the large-scale structure of the universe. At these vast distances, cosmic expansion becomes significant and Hubble's Law relates distance to redshift.
History & Origin : Became essential with the discovery of the expanding universe in the 1920s. The Hubble Constant (≈70 km/s/Mpc) defines the expansion rate. Modern cosmology routinely deals with hundreds to thousands of megaparsecs.
Current Use : Measures distances between galaxy clusters and superclusters. The cosmic web's filaments span 100+ Mpc. Used in dark matter mapping and studies of large-scale structure formation.
Details for Twip (Precision Typography)
Introduction : The twip equals 1/20 of a point (1/1440 inch or 17.64 µm), providing ultra-precise typographic control. This tiny unit enables fine positioning in digital document formats and graphic design applications.
History & Origin : Developed for Microsoft Windows as 'twentieth of a point' (TWentieth of an Imperial Point). Used internally in Windows API since version 1.0 (1985) for device-independent measurements.
Current Use : Used in Word documents for precise object placement. Common in vector graphics file formats. 1440 twips = 1 inch in Windows systems. Enables WYSIWYG display across resolutions.
